This second volume of the "Handbook of Polyhydroxyalkanoates (PHA):
Kinetics, Bioengineering and Industrial Aspects" focusses on
thermodynamic and mathematical considerations of PHA biosynthesis,
bioengineering aspects regarding bioreactor design and downstream
processing for PHA recovery from microbial biomass. It covers
microbial mixed culture processes and includes a strong
industry-focused section with chapters on the economics of PHA
production, industrial-scale PHA production from sucrose, next
generation industrial biotechnology approaches for PHA production
based on novel robust production strains, and holistic techno-economic
and sustainability considerations on PHA manufacturing. Aimed at
professionals and graduate students in Polymer (plastic) industry,
wastewater treatment plants, food industry, biodiesel industry, this
book Provides an insight into microbial thermodynamics to reveal the
central domain governing in PHA formation, both aerobically and
anaerobically. Includes systematic overview of mathematical modelling
approaches, starting from low-structured and formal kinetic models
until modern tools like metabolic models, cybernetic models and so
forth Discusses challenges during scale up of PHA production processes
and on development of non-sterile processes and
contamination-resistant strains Presents a holistic picture of the
current state of PHA research by mixed cultures Reviews the
industry-related point of view about current and future trends in PHA
production and processing
